Foaming agents, often referred to as blowing agents, work by releasing gas during the plastic processing stage. This controlled release of gas creates a cellular structure within the polymer. The primary benefit for manufacturers is the substantial reduction in part weight, which translates directly into lower raw material consumption and, consequently, reduced production costs. Imagine cutting the weight of your plastic components by up to 20% – this can lead to considerable savings, especially in high-volume production environments. Furthermore, lighter products mean lower shipping costs and a reduced environmental footprint, aligning with growing sustainability demands.

Factors such as the agent's decomposition temperature, gas yield, and compatibility with your specific polymer (like PVC, TPR, or PS) are critical. For instance, agents designed for specific resins ensure optimal activation at processing temperatures, preventing issues like poor surface finish or premature decomposition. The application of these agents extends across various plastic manufacturing processes, including injection molding and extrusion. By carefully selecting and dosing the appropriate foaming agent, manufacturers can not only achieve weight reduction but also eliminate common defects like sink marks. This leads to improved aesthetic appeal and structural integrity of the final product.
